The set up
AEMO found in its Victorian Annual Planning Report that the 220 kV transmission corridor between Moorabool, Geelong, Deer Park and Keilor is anticipated to become heavily constrained over the coming decade.
VicGrid found similar, with its Victorian Transmission Plan 2025 putting forward significant investment for the Western Victoria reinforcement program, proposing upgrading the existing substations of Elaine, South Morang, Keilor, Deer Park and increasing the capacity of the Ballarat to Moorabool 220 kV line.
For its South West expansion program, VicGrid propose a new double circuit 500 kV line from Tarrone to Truganina and a new single circuit 500 kV line from Truganina to Sydenham by 2033. This program includes a new 500/220 kV substation at Truganina and high-capacity 220 kV lines to Deer Park and Keilor to provide an alternative flow path from the proposed REZs into Melbourne and service the potential new large loads in this area.
Deer Park Terminal Station
Deer Park Terminal Station (DPTS) is located in the Melbourne West Growth Corridor.
DPTS has two 225 MVA 220/66 kV transformers with nominal N-1 capacity of 225 MVA and associated equipment as transmission connection assets to supply the local Powercor network. It is connected into one of the three 220 kV circuits that connect Keilor Terminal Station and Geelong Terminal Station.
Upgrades to DPTS need to occur.
Due to continued growth in demand across the network catchment area served by DPTS, including the proposed connection of the new Mt Cottrell Zone Substation and committed major loads have reduced capacity at DPTS during periods of high demand, the firm capacity of DPTS has been exceeded and the energy at risk in the event of a transformer failure is forecast to become significant from 2027.
The 50th percentile summer forecast rises from 367 MVA in 2026 to 542 MVA in 2028 – a 47% increase in two years, against a recorded peak of 324 MVA and a firm rating of 225 MVA.
Powercor attributes this growth to high population growth alongside increasing commercial and industrial customer connections. It does not explicitly call out data centre loads but there is no way suburban population growth can move a summer peak forecast by 47% in two years.
By summer of 2029-30, Powercor forecasts peak demand will exceed the import capacity of the station outright, leading to the very real possibility for the need to shed load.
The fix for DPTS
Powercor identified one credible network option of installing a third 225 MVA 220/66 kV transformer at DPTS. A third transformer allows more supply which in turn would overload the 220 kV lines feeding the station, so it requires the two existing Geelong-Keilor 220 kV circuits to be cut into DPTS as part of the works. Total cost comes to $86 million.
Powercor put the total transfer capability from Deer Park to Altona West, Altona-Brooklyn and Keilor at 33.9 MVA in summer 2025/26 — against a forecast peak of 542 MVA in 2028. Because of the low available spare capacity in the broader area and the increasing load growth, Powercor concluded transferring load between stations is not a viable long-term solution.
One item that needs reconciling with VicGrid. The 2025 Victorian Transmission Plan lists switching the Geelong-Keilor circuits into Deer Park at $50 million with a 2029 date. Powercor price the cut in of the two Geelong-Keilor circuits at $66 million with works needing to begin from 2027. The scope of works may not be identical but the two public documents carry different costs and delivery dates which VicGrid may need to clarify.
So for a data centre circling DPTS, there is no capacity until the load shedding risk is remediated.
Truganina Terminal Station
VicGrid’s $410 million Truganina Terminal Station does not yet exist. The 2025 Victorian Transmission Plan’s south west expansion program has an in-service date for the station of 2033 for TTS and two 220kV double circuit lines connecting TTS to DPTS. And in VicGrid’s own words, a location still to be determined, albeit its Victorian Transmission Plan indicates it is ~8km away from DPTS.
VicGrid note that after redirecting the two Geelong to Kilor lines that currently by-pass Deer Park and turning them into Deer Park is complete, DPTS will be supplied from Geelong Terminal Station. After TSS is complete, DPTS will be supplied from Keilor.
The non-network door is open
There has got to be a way forward to better shift load amongst the terminal stations of the Melbourne West Growth Corridor to unlock capacity for data centre investment.
Powercor considered a confidential non-network option proposal to address the load constraints at DPTS, proposing increasing capacity by 8.8 MW with an expansion up to 40 MW firm capacity available no earlier than 2028. But this proposal was rejected as it would only defer the capacity constraints by no more than 6 months.
It would need to be a much larger proposal, and one that satisfies the increasingly strict and complex rules for data centres to comply with when seeking electrons in the National Electricity Market.
This could look like installing a significant grid-scale battery precinct to help shift the load amongst the proliferation of west Melbourne terminal stations and/or more sharply manage the peak demand in the summer months – which is the crux of the problem.
It would need to be lodged with Powercor in concert with VicGrid with the latter likely to be somewhat distracted by a brand new energy minister, a substantial internal restructure and preparing red, blue and orange books for the 28 November Victorian State Election.
What this means for investors
The majority of data centre interest in Victoria has been focused on deploying in the Melbourne West Growth Corridor.
DPTS’s bottleneck is two transformers that step down 220 kV to 66 kV for Powercor’s network. They are rated at 225 MVA, there is no spare capacity and every data centre looking to locate near TTS draws power from them.
A data centre connecting at 220 kV does not use those transformers at all. It takes power upstream of the bottleneck, so it is not competing for the same 225 MVA.
There are possibly three locations to do this:
DPTS as it is about to receive two more Geelong-Keilor 220 kV circuits from 2027.
At a new connection point along one of the Keilor-Geelong circuits; or
At another terminal station such as Altona Terminal Station West and Keilor Terminal Station.
Any of the three options would definitely require a connection enquiry lodged with VicGrid to confirm.
